MACEDON, Kingdom of, Perseus (179-168 B.C.), AE 17, (6.0 grams), obv. Perseus head to right with winged cap, rev. eagle, wings opened on thunderbolt, B [A] above, **P to left of eagle, (cf.S.6807, SNG Evelpides 1464, SNG Cop. 1275). Black patina, surface roughness, otherwise good very fine.
